still no idea

This commit is contained in:
xGinko 2024-02-21 21:29:15 +01:00
parent 4024614f85
commit aadb1a00ba
3 changed files with 7 additions and 0 deletions

View File

@ -107,6 +107,11 @@
<version>1.20.4-R0.1-SNAPSHOT</version> <version>1.20.4-R0.1-SNAPSHOT</version>
<scope>provided</scope> <scope>provided</scope>
</dependency> </dependency>
<dependency>
<groupId>com.google.auto.service</groupId>
<artifactId>auto-service</artifactId>
<version>1.1.1</version>
</dependency>
<!-- Adventure API for easier cross-version compatibility --> <!-- Adventure API for easier cross-version compatibility -->
<dependency> <dependency>
<groupId>net.kyori</groupId> <groupId>net.kyori</groupId>

View File

@ -1,11 +1,13 @@
package me.xginko.villageroptimizer.logging; package me.xginko.villageroptimizer.logging;
import com.google.auto.service.AutoService;
import net.kyori.adventure.text.logger.slf4j.ComponentLogger; import net.kyori.adventure.text.logger.slf4j.ComponentLogger;
import net.kyori.adventure.text.logger.slf4j.ComponentLoggerProvider; import net.kyori.adventure.text.logger.slf4j.ComponentLoggerProvider;
import net.kyori.adventure.text.serializer.ansi.ANSIComponentSerializer; import net.kyori.adventure.text.serializer.ansi.ANSIComponentSerializer;
import org.jetbrains.annotations.NotNull; import org.jetbrains.annotations.NotNull;
import org.slf4j.LoggerFactory; import org.slf4j.LoggerFactory;
@AutoService(ComponentLoggerProvider.class)
@SuppressWarnings("UnstableApiUsage") @SuppressWarnings("UnstableApiUsage")
public final class ComponentLoggerProviderImpl implements ComponentLoggerProvider { public final class ComponentLoggerProviderImpl implements ComponentLoggerProvider {
private static final ANSIComponentSerializer SERIALIZER = ANSIComponentSerializer.builder() private static final ANSIComponentSerializer SERIALIZER = ANSIComponentSerializer.builder()